PC-90II Phone Holder

Compatibility

The holder is compatible with a wide range of smartphones, thanks to its adjustable extend length of 5.6-9cm.

Mounting Plate

Equipped with an Arca standard bottom plate, it can be easily attached to various tripods and stands.

Mounting Screw/Hole

Features a UNC 1/4" screw for secure attachment.

Load Capacity

The phone holder can support a maximum load of 3kg, making it suitable for even larger smartphones.

Weight

Lightweight at just 144g, ensuring that it doesn't add significant bulk to your setup.
